What companies run services between Calamba, Philippines and New Era University, Philippines?

Philippine National Railways operates a train from Calamba to EDSA/Magallanes once daily. Tickets cost ₱30–55 and the journey takes 1h 50m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Calamba Crossing to New Era University via Manila Buendia, Epifanio de los Santos Avenue / Senator Gil Puyat Ave, Makati City, Manila, and Commonwealth Avenue, Quezon City in around 3h 6m.
